Join the Ulster County Historical Society and we turn to one of the most remarkable land grants in New York history: the 1708 Hardenbergh Patent. Originally pitched to the Colonial Government as a request for a 7mall tract of land,8 it ballooned into a grant larger than the State of Rhode Island. Presenter Thomas Soja will unveil a long-lost 1749 survey map, challenge long-accepted historical narratives, and resolve a centuries-old question about the Hardenbergh claim to Mesopotamia and Point Mountain at the Wedding of the Waters, where the East and West Branches of the Delaware River meet.
